Vikas Choudhary, Developer in Jaipur, Rajasthan, India
Vikas is available for hire
Hire Vikas

Vikas Choudhary

Verified Expert  in Engineering

Bio

Vikas is an expert MuleSoft and Workato engineer passionate about delivering reusable APIs and integration with a high level of automation in testing and DevOps tooling. He has 12 years of experience in API development and automated integration using Mule 3, Mule 4, Workato, and Jakarta EE. He holds certifications as a MuleSoft Integration Architect, Mulesoft Platform Architect, Mulesoft Dev, and Workato Automation Pro I, II, and III. Vikas has developed many integrations using Mule and Workato.

Portfolio

Visium SA
Salesforce, MuleSoft, Git, Java, APIs, Data Transformation, DataWeave...
Splitit, Inc
Workato, APIs, NetSuite, Business Services, Automation
Z-Tech
MuleSoft, REST APIs, API Design, API Architecture, Apache Kafka, Integration...

Experience

Availability

Full-time

Preferred Environment

API Architecture, API Platforms, API Development, API Design, API Integration, APIs, Workato, MuleSoft, Integration, System Integration

The most amazing...

...migration I delivered included a complete payment-driven bank website from legacy to APIs using MuleSoft.

Work Experience

Mulesoft Developer and Architect

2023 - 2024
Visium SA
  • Worked as an integration technology architect on the adoption of hybrid integration or an EPOS solution with a particular focus on the Mulesoft Anypoint platform that includes API designer, AP manager, and API studio.
  • Defined and delivered the integration technology aspects of the projects, including the timely production of architectural designs and documentation.
  • Acted as a key contributor and advocate of microservices, API management, process automation, and frameworks in projects and programs.
  • Communicated the implementation approach and design methodology to the offshore development team.
  • Participated in a Technical Design Authority to assess and quantify the risks associated with design decisions and communicate these to the relevant parties.
Technologies: Salesforce, MuleSoft, Git, Java, APIs, Data Transformation, DataWeave, Anypoint Studio, Data Integration

Workato Expert

2023 - 2023
Splitit, Inc
  • Collaborated with the team to fine-tune and optimize the Workato implementation. Developed and implemented strategies to address any challenges during the final stages of transition.
  • Ensured a seamless and successful go-live for the Workato connector between our database and NetSuite.
  • Contributed to enhancing the payment experience for customers and clients.
Technologies: Workato, APIs, NetSuite, Business Services, Automation

Senior MuleSoft/Integration Developer

2021 - 2022
Z-Tech
  • Started a MuleSoft practice in the company and formed a C4E team. The team's main focus was creating reusable APIs across multiple projects and verticals and setting up best practices across all APIs.
  • Set up the MuleSoft platform from scratch. Created different environments like DevOp, staging, and production, and the VPC for production and non-production environments. Built the VPN tunnel between the on-prem Azure and MuleSoft CloudHub VPCs.
  • Architected, designed, and developed large MuleSoft integration programs for various parts of a payment and banking system. Some of them involved very high throughputs and low response times. Provided design and code review for MuleSoft APIs.
  • Collaborated with various program stakeholders (program managers, scrum masters, solution architects, security architects, and MuleSoft development teams) to ensure a seamless MuleSoft delivery as part of the program.
  • Created heavy ETL processes using batch processing to load sizable data from files and pushed validated data to Salesforce.
Technologies: MuleSoft, REST APIs, API Design, API Architecture, Apache Kafka, Integration, Workato, Git, Robotic Process Automation (RPA)

Senior MuleSoft Consultant Specialist

2019 - 2021
HSBC
  • Started a MuleSoft practice in my vertical and was part of the C4E team. The team's main focus was to create reusable APIs across multiple projects and verticals and set up best practices across all APIs.
  • Architected, designed, and developed large MuleSoft integration programs for various parts of a payment and banking system. Some of them involved very high throughputs and low response times. Provided design and code review for MuleSoft APIs.
  • Migrated an existing legacy payment system from the mainframe to APIs using the MuleSoft three-tier API-led connectivity. Developed a template summary, FX transaction, payment creation, and an authorization module.
  • Oversaw the end-to-end delivery from a MuleSoft API perspective.
  • Led and mentored ten junior developers for MuleSoft-related technical challenges.
  • Collaborated with various program stakeholders (program managers, scrum masters, solution architects, security architects, and MuleSoft development teams) to ensure a seamless MuleSoft delivery as part of the program.
Technologies: MuleSoft, Mule ESB, APIs, Java, Architecture, API Platforms, SQL, Integration, Git

Senior MuleSoft Consultant

2018 - 2019
International SOS
  • Designed and developed REST APIs using MuleSoft for LIMO APP in cab bookings.
  • Deployed MuleSoft APIs on cloud-hub by creating a VPC.
  • Used all MuleSoft components for full API life-cycle management such as the design center, Anypoint Exchange, API Manger, API monitoring, and Runtime Manager.
  • Oversaw the end-to-end delivery of the MuleSoft API.
  • Collaborated with various program stakeholders (program managers, scrum masters, solution architects, security architects, and MuleSoft development teams) to ensure a seamless MuleSoft delivery as part of the program.
Technologies: MuleSoft, APIs, API Design, API Development, Cloud, SQL, Integration, Git, Retail & Wholesale

Senior MuleSoft Developer

2016 - 2018
TIAA
  • Migrated the existing IVR application from Spring MVC to MuleSoft APIs using API-led connectivity.
  • Improved IVR application performance by creating highly performant MuleSoft APIs using MuleSoft components.
  • Set up guidelines and standards for API development across the organization.
  • Oversaw the end-to-end MuleSoft API delivery.
  • Collaborated with various program stakeholders (program managers, scrum masters, solution architects, security architects, and MuleSoft development teams) to ensure a seamless MuleSoft delivery as part of the program.
Technologies: MuleSoft, APIs, Spring, Java, Spring Boot, SQL, Integration, Microsoft SQL Server, Git

Senior API Developer

2015 - 2016
Cybage
  • Developed a web application using Spring, Java, and Spring Data JPA.
  • Created reusable rest APIs used across multiple flows.
  • Improved legacy application performance by moving it to APIs using Spring.
Technologies: Java, Spring, Spring MVC, Spring Data JPA, REST APIs, SQL, Git

Software Developer

2013 - 2015
Nuance
  • Developed an IVR application in Cisco Call Studio and Nuance NDF using NDM, NVP, and VUI review testing.
  • Created Rest APIs using Spring for API application for international clients.
  • Oversaw the final product delivery to onsite and daily onsite calls for pending issues.
Technologies: Java, Spring, Hibernate

Software Developer

2011 - 2013
Infosys
  • Developed web application using Java, J2EE, Spring , Hibernate and SQL.
  • created Rest APIs for high performance and reusability.
  • Migrated legacy code to APIs using Java and Spring.
Technologies: Java, Spring, APIs

MoveMoney

https://www.hsbcnet.com/
MoveMoney was one of the most important projects under the Payments Transformation Scheme. MoveMoney is a completely new flow covering almost all countries and payment types such as PP, IAT, and bill payments accommodating conventional transaction service tools. I created the payment and template instructions, payment and authorization summary, and template summary with an option to add a beneficiary.

TIAA Direct

TIAA Direct is an IVR application used by customers for all their queries and suggestion. Verified customers can do payment transactions, fund transfers, balance checks, and other operations.

Cybage Marketing Tool

Created web based application oriented to serve the
purpose of creating an Email platform for Marketing
team of Cybage.It consists of various modules like
Admin, asset, campaign and reporting. its used across multiples verticals for marketing work.

Customer Health Management Tool

Created a web application for Aetna to maintain health records for patients using Spring MVC. This application is used by all active patients to get their past health history. Aetena uses this application for future health predictions and suggestions.
2007 - 2011

Bachelor's Degree in Information Technology

Pune University - Pune, India

AUGUST 2023 - PRESENT

Workato Automation Pro III

Workato

AUGUST 2023 - PRESENT

Workato Automation Pro II

Workato

JANUARY 2023 - PRESENT

Workato Automation Pro I

Workato

JANUARY 2021 - PRESENT

MuleSoft Certified Platform Architect

MuleSoft

JANUARY 2021 - PRESENT

MuleSoft Certified Integration Architect

MuleSoft

DECEMBER 2020 - PRESENT

MuleSoft Certified Developer - (Mule 4)

MuleSoft

DECEMBER 2019 - PRESENT

MuleSoft Certified Developer - Integration and API Associate (Mule 3)

MuleSoft

Libraries/APIs

API Development, REST APIs

Tools

Anypoint Studio, Git

Platforms

MuleSoft, Mule ESB, Windows, Mule Runtime Engine, Workato, Apache Kafka, Salesforce

Storage

Data Integration, Spring Data JPA, Microsoft SQL Server

Languages

Java, SQL

Frameworks

Spring, Spring MVC, Spring Batch, Hibernate, Spring Boot

Industry Expertise

Retail & Wholesale

Paradigms

API Architecture, Automation

Other

API Integration, API Design, APIs, Integration, Data Transformation, DataWeave, Software Development, Architecture, API Platforms, Robotic Process Automation (RPA), Cloud, System Integration, NetSuite, Business Services

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ring